Output 3c268d299c353042dcc3180dcf11d5197dc7f80be65404b5434d6d78642cc756:2

value
35230689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 349e07de0e52066ac3896229728b377485d4384b OP_EQUAL
address
MChNgaCFrrH8zzL9XgsaoqLiL9BrHEbrTo
transaction
3c268d299c353042dcc3180dcf11d5197dc7f80be65404b5434d6d78642cc756
spent
true